About The Position

SPX is a diverse team of unique individuals who all make an impact. As a Production Material Handler, you will help keep manufacturing running by accurately pulling, issuing, staging, and delivering parts and materials to production work areas. You will use production orders and inventory information to locate the correct parts, maintain inventory accuracy, and ensure manufacturing teams have the materials they need to complete customer orders safely and on time.

Responsibilities

  • Follow all safety rules and adhere to core value of business.
  • Maintain clean, orderly work areas and equipment.
  • Report repairs and/or issues to team lead or supervisor.
  • Review production orders, pick lists, or material requests to determine required parts and quantities.
  • Locate and accurately pull parts, components, hardware, and materials from designated inventory locations.
  • Issue materials to production orders and accurately record inventory transactions.
  • Stage and deliver parts and materials to designated production work areas.
  • Verify part numbers, descriptions, quantities, and work orders before issuing materials.
  • Identify shortages, incorrect parts, or inventory discrepancies and promptly communicate issues to the appropriate team member or supervisor.
  • Return unused materials to the correct inventory location and complete required inventory transactions.
  • Operate forklifts, pallet jacks, carts, and other material-handling equipment safely.
  • Maintain accurate inventory locations and quantities through proper material transactions.
  • Assist with cycle counts and physical inventory activities.
  • Investigate and report inventory discrepancies.
  • Maintain organized and clearly identified parts and material storage locations.
  • Follow FIFO or other established material-control processes where applicable.
  • Support continuous improvement efforts related to material flow, inventory accuracy, and production efficiency.
